The State Tax Service (STS) under the Economy Ministry of Azerbaijan and the National Revenue Committee of Kazakhstan have begun talks on a new Convention project on the elimination of double taxation with respect to taxes on income and property and the prevention of tax evasion, Report informs, citing the STS.
Orkhan Musayev, head of the International Taxation and Tax Monitoring Main Department of the STS, Ablaikhan Bagibekov, Deputy Director of the Tax and Customs Legislation Department at the Ministry of Finance of Kazakhstan, and Kymbat Ibrayeva, Deputy Head of the Non-resident Taxation Department of the State Revenue Committee of Kazakhstan, are participating in the relevant meeting.
In September 1996, Azerbaijan and Kazakhstan signed a Convention on the elimination of double taxation with respect to taxes on income and property and the prevention of tax evasion. This agreement came into force on January 1, 1998.
In April 2017, the parties signed a protocol as an addition to this agreement, removing property-related clauses from it. This protocol came into force on January 1, 2019.
